J4+ bootlogo extracted. - Samsung Galaxy J4+ Guides, News, & Discussion

Hi. I tried to help finding and replacing the bootlogo for this device, but it turned out it's located inside aboot.mbn which is Samsungs OEM bootloader. It won't be possible changing it, or at least I won't because of the risks of messing with bootloader.
I've never done that before, plus I don't own this device myself.
I got it extracted though so I thought I'd leave the logo here any way, in case someone wants it for something.

What model phone do you have? Is it SGH-I777?
What do you mean by .pid file? Do you mean a .pit file? And you don't use a zip file in Odin, you need a .tar file for Odin.
Or are you using mobile odin?
There is not enough information here to hazard a guess, but I'll guess anyway that you used the wrong firmware or the wrong pit file, and damaged the partition table.
If you will provide more detailed information perhaps a we can give a better answer.
Creepy is right, wrong firmware is the cause. SenseWiz rom has never been available for the i777, not even in a ported version. If that's really what you flashed it will never boot for you; use the 'Return/Unbrick to Stock' from creepyncrawly's signature to recover your device, then never flash anything you're not 100% certain is compatible with your device.
